Residential Pest Control in Katy, TX
Residential pest control services focus on identifying, managing, and eliminating common household pests such as ants, cockroaches, spiders, termites, and rodents. These services typically cover a range of projects including routine inspections, targeted treatments for infested areas, and preventative measures to reduce the likelihood of future pest problems. Homeowners often seek these services to protect their living spaces from damage, maintain a clean environment, and ensure the safety of their families and pets.
Before requesting residential pest control, property owners usually want to understand the scope of treatment options available, the types of pests that can be effectively managed, and any preparations needed prior to service. It is also helpful to inquire about the frequency of treatments, the safety of products used around children and pets, and the expected results. Clear communication about these aspects can help homeowners make informed decisions and achieve the best possible outcomes for their residences.

Residential Pest Control Questions
What pests are commonly treated with residential pest control? Common pests include ants, cockroaches, spiders, termites, and rodents.
How can I prevent pests from returning after treatment? Keep the property clean, seal entry points, and remove food sources to reduce attractants.
Is pest control safe for children and pets? Yes, treatments are designed to be safe when proper procedures are followed around homes.
What signs indicate a pest infestation? Visible pests, droppings, damaged belongings, and unusual odors are common signs of an infestation.
